PLL status: Shows if an S/PDIF (or AES/EBU) connection is made. If Lock is displayed, an
S/PDIF (or AES/EBU) signal is detected at the specific input. If Unlock is
displayed, no signal is detected.
Format: - Professional (IEC 958 Type 1): EX8000 digital in/out format is AES/EBU.
- Consumer (IEC 958 Type II): EX8000 digital in/out format is S/PDIF.
Note that you can set this to Professional but keep the RCA (S/PDIF) port. This would
allow you to process an AES/EBU signal coming in on an unbalanced S/PDIF cable.
